A sovereign wealth fund is an investment fund, a state-owned pool of money, with funding coming from surplus reserves from state-owned enterprises, reserves from budgeting excesses, foreign currency operations, and money from privatizations that is invested in various financial assets.

House Bill 6398 will establish the “Maharlika Investment Fund” , the purpose of which is to “generate consistent and stable investment returns with appropriate risk limits to preserve and enhance long term value of the Fund, obtain the best absolute return and achievable financial gains on its investments, and to satisfy the requirements of liquidity, safety/security, and yield in order to ensure profitability.

We have some concerns about funding coming from “public borrowing, among others” and “other investments.”
